Description

Waterfront oasis in Long Beach offering everything you desire in a beachfront residence, complete with breathtaking views of the NYC skyline and sunsets. This expansive home features all en-suite bedrooms, generous common areas, an inviting inground pool, and an impressive 138 feet of ocean frontage. With a dining veranda and multiple boat docks, it stands as one of the most substantial houses in Long Beach. Crafted with enduring quality, the house boasts solid brick construction and a slate roof, encompassing over 5000 sq feet of living space. Designed for convivial gatherings, the oversized double-sided Chef's kitchen is well-equipped to cater to a crowd. A grand living room with a fireplace, a front den/office with a powder room, and upper bedrooms, each with en-suite facilities, water views, and private terraces, contribute to the home's luxurious appeal. The primary bedroom is a sanctuary, featuring a spa bath, dual oversized walk-in closets, and panoramic water views. The first floor hosts two additional bedrooms with full baths, and flexible spaces that can serve as extra guest rooms. Live epically, Live by the bay!
